  14. Cooling ideas anyone?

    You will most likely need another fan. I put a pusher on mine when the factory pusher was and wired it to a thermo switch. This is a lot easier if you don't have AC. Throw a 180 thermostat back in it, the car will like it more than the 160.

  27. Just an FYI, fuel filler tubes

    It's the lower part. Mine cracked on the bottom side where it enter the tank. A trail of fuel behind the car and puddles at stoplights are kind of a troubling sight.
  28. Just an FYI, fuel filler tubes

    They are still available from Mitsu. There has been talk for years about the last ones being hoarded and sold and will soon be NLA. I just picked mine up, but it cost me over $60. The material seems to be different than the original pieces and they're gray in color.Just wanted to let you guys...
